How Do Split Systems Work?

Air conditioning splits have the name because of one half of the system (condenser) located outside the house while the other half (fan coil) is located inside. When it cools, warm air inside the room is brought in through the fan coil and removed, resulting in cool air being recirculated back into the home. The reverse cycle permits the heat pump to operate in reverse, providing heating on cold winter days.

Systems for split air conditioners can be placed in rooms, areas or even multiple rooms linked by copper pipe connecting to the outdoor unit (condenser). Systems with multi-head splits can be set up in more than nine rooms and only one outdoor unit, and allowing for an individual temperature control for each room.

Tips For Using A Split System

  • Set the thermostat between 24C and 26C to cool. Every degree lower in summer increases the running cost by approximately 10%..
  • Utilize the economy setting in the event that your split system is equipped with one. Ensure that you regularly service your air cooling system.
  • Make sure that the sun’s heat is kept out by closing the curtains and exterior blinds in the morning. Close windows and doors to areas that are being cooled while your split systems are in operation.
  • When the split system has been switched off and its cooler outside, you can open doors or windows and let cool air inside.
  • Insulate your house to block the warm summer days out and cool in the winter months.
  • Wear clothes that are appropriate for the weather.

Why Choose A Split System?

Air conditioning units mounted in wall are the most frequently used air conditioning systems for homes because they’re affordable and easy to maintain.

Inverter Technology

Inverter technology is your key to more comfort throughout the year because it maintains the temperature at a constant level, reduces costs (less energy use) and produces relatively less noise when utilized. This is accomplished by managing the speed of the compressor more precisely.

Affordable

Wall mounted Split AC units are your most budget option for a small room apartment or small house as they are comparatively inexpensive to purchase (depending on the number of indoor units you require) and they don’t require necessary duct work.

Independent Temperature Control

Each indoor unit has the ability to control the area it is installed in, thus each room may have various temperature.

Air Quality

Many HVAC systems that are split have air filtering functions and humidity control which regulate the amount of dust and humidity that can be found in the space. This allows for sensitive customers (children older, asthmatic, or allergic people) an unwinding mind and body.

Multi-Head Split Systems

Multi-Head Split Systems allow different indoor units to connect to one outdoor condenser that in turn provides you with the convenience of having the ideal cooling system (in terms of physical and output constraints) for a particular room.

How long will it take to set up a split system air conditioner?

In general the typical AC split installation can take between 3-6 hours. However, the exact amount of time could vary based on various factors like below:

  • Location and size of both the outdoor and indoor unit
  • Copper pipes that are routed between outdoor and indoor units
  • Electrical connections from main switchboard to the A/C unit.

What size of split system air conditioning do I need?

A standard measurements ratio is multiple the area of the room by a factor of 0.15 to calculate the necessary power of the unit in kilowatt.

For a room with a size of 40 square metres, you’ll require a split air conditioning system of 6 kW. An air conditioning unit of 2.5kW is perfect for 10 -20 sqm room areas.

However, the size of the Split system’s air conditioning requirements is also affected by other variables such as the room insulation, size of the room, and’ locations.

How long will a split system air conditioner last?

In general air conditioners are constructed to last for 10-20 years on average. However, this is contingent upon a myriad of elements, such as the brand of the A/C, quality of the installation, regular service history, etc…

It is important to service your Split System Air Conditioner often to prolong lifetime and enhance effectiveness.

What is the best frequency to clean my air conditioner’s air filter?

Based on Daikin Australia, it is strongly suggested that you should cleanse your air conditioning filters every 2 weeks to increase the efficiency of your system and possibly decrease your energy use by 5%-15%.
